报告摘要:
The widespread applications of Michaelis-Menten kinetics in enzymes kinetics have persisted since their discovery. T. L. Hill demonstrated a more theoretical approach and general results in the characterization of cooperativity in enzymes kinetics. In this talk, I first introduce the background of the book“Cooperativity Theory in Biochemistry: Steady-State and Equilibrium Systems”. Then, I show some derivation of stationary distribution of ligand binding for small systems without and with explicit interaction cooperativity, using grand canonical formalism. Finally, some applications in microbial growth are also discussed.
个人简介:
Junwen Mao is a professor of physics in Huzhou University. She obtained Bachelor’s degree in Engineering Thermophysics from Universityof Science and Technologyof Chinain1992, and Ph.D in physics from Zhejiang University in 2006. Her research interests include statistical physics and computational biology.
